Fragen zu CreateHTMLView

Übersicht BlitzMax, BlitzMax NG Allgemein

Neue Antwort erstellen

 

danibert

Betreff: Fragen zu CreateHTMLView

BeitragMo, Mai 07, 2012 17:02
Antworten mit Zitat
Benutzer-Profile anzeigen
Hallo,

ich habe 2 Fragen zu CreateHTMLView:

- Ist es möglich, rechts keinen Scrollbalken anzuzeigen? Aktuell bekomme ich diesen immer angezeigt, egal ob er nötig ist oder nicht. Ich möchte ihn komplett unterdrücken.

- In der Doku habe ich gelesen, dass CreateHTMLView auf Internet Explorer basiert. Funktioniert der Befehl auch auf Linux und Mac? Wird dort evtl. der Standardbrowser genutzt?

Danke für alle Infos

Midimaster

BeitragMo, Mai 07, 2012 17:06
Antworten mit Zitat
Benutzer-Profile anzeigen
wenn der html-Inhalt komplett in das Fenster passt, werden keine Scrollbalken angezeigt. Du musst also dafür sorgen, dass vor dem Anzeigen der Inhalt angepasst (reduziert) wird.
Gewinner des BCC #53 mit "Gitarrist vs Fussballer" http://www.midimaster.de/downl...ssball.exe
 

danibert

BeitragMo, Mai 07, 2012 17:13
Antworten mit Zitat
Benutzer-Profile anzeigen
@Midimaster:
Der Scrollblken selbst, wird natürlich nur angezeigt, wenn es etwas zu scrollen gibt. Der Bereich wo der scrollbalken erscheint, ist aber immer grau hinterlegt. Das hätte ich gerne verhindert.

Thunder

BeitragMo, Mai 07, 2012 17:20
Antworten mit Zitat
Benutzer-Profile anzeigen
Zur Frage 2: Bist du sicher, das nicht in der BlitzPlus-Hilfe gelesen zu haben? Auf Windows ist das zwar richtig, aber CreateHTMLView würde wohl nicht besonders gut auf Linux funktionieren, wenn es auch auf Linux auf IE basieren würde.
Wie genau der Programmierer von MaxGUI es gemacht hat, kann ich dir nicht sagen, nur dass es auch auf Linux (und MacOS X) funktioniert und demnach zumindest auf Linux anders funktionieren muss (und es funktioniert - gerade getestet).
Meine Sachen: https://bitbucket.org/chtisgit https://github.com/chtisgit
 

danibert

BeitragMo, Mai 07, 2012 17:28
Antworten mit Zitat
Benutzer-Profile anzeigen
@Thunder
ich habe es hier auf der Seite gelesen, dort steht das mit IE dabei.

Danke für die Infos

Propellator

BeitragMo, Mai 07, 2012 18:42
Antworten mit Zitat
Benutzer-Profile anzeigen
CreateHTMLView in der Hilfe hier ist auf BlitzPlus bezogen, wie das Icon eigentlich sagt.
Das BlitzMax CreateHTMLView ist plattformunabhängig.

Zu den Scrollbalken: Ich habe mich tief in den BRL Source und die MSDN gewagt, und bin bis jetzt nur auf wirklich hässliche Lösungen gestossen. Ich werde mich mal weiter umschauen
Propellator - Alles andere ist irrelephant.
Elefanten sind die Könige der Antarktis.

Midimaster

BeitragMo, Mai 07, 2012 19:53
Antworten mit Zitat
Benutzer-Profile anzeigen
"workaround"...

BlitzMax: [AUSKLAPPEN]
Import MaxGUI.Drivers
Local flags%=WINDOW_DEFAULT|WINDOW_CLIENTCOORDS'|WINDOW_CENTER
Window= CreateWindow("test" , 200 , 200 ,800,600 , Null , Flags%)
panel=CreatePanel(100,100,600,400,Window,PANEL_BORDER)
html=CreateHTMLView(0,0,650,450,panel)
HtmlViewGo html,"www.blitzmax.com"

While WaitEvent()
Select EventID()
Case EVENT_WINDOWCLOSE
End
End Select
Wend
Gewinner des BCC #53 mit "Gitarrist vs Fussballer" http://www.midimaster.de/downl...ssball.exe

The Shark

BeitragMo, Mai 07, 2012 22:22
Antworten mit Zitat
Benutzer-Profile anzeigen
Wenn du den Anzeigeninhalt sleber generierst, kannst die scrollleisten mit css unterdrücken, wenns ne fremde Seite ist, mit nem iframe. Bei dem kann man die Scrollleisten per html unterdrücken.

Neue Antwort erstellen


Übersicht BlitzMax, BlitzMax NG Allgemein

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group